MacBook Pro 2016 could be released in the upcoming Apple event on March 21, alongside a new 9.7-inch iPad Pro, according to new rumors. However, Apple has not yet announced the list of its products scheduled for launch at the March 21 event, so a new MacBook by next week is still unconfirmed.

The March 21 event of the company will reportedly focus on the iPhone SE and iPad Air 3. But several talks suggest it is possible that a separate Mac event will be organized by the software company. Nevertheless, a lot of tech experts still believe that Apple will announce the new MacBook Pro during the upcoming event, Lawyer Herald reported.

If at all the MacBook Pro 2016 is released, it might feature  sixth generation Intel Skylake processors, as the rivals including Microsoft, Dell and HP have already started shipping laptops with the latest processor.

The MacBook Pro 2016 is expected to launch in three variants: 12-inch, 13-inch and a 15-inch model and all of these variants will feature Retina display.

Christian Today noted, the 12-inch MacBook possesses some impressive specifications, which include new design improvements and upgrades in its interior features, such as the newest Intel processors and sixth generation chipsets and Skylake architecture.
